Edwin Lee WITCOMBE

WITCOMBE, Edwin Lee

Service Number: 845
Enlisted: 1 August 1915, Liverpool, NSW
Last Rank: Private
Last Unit: 4th Infantry Battalion, Naval and Military Forces - Special Tropical Corps
Born: Waterloo, New South Wales, Australia, 11 February 1888
Home Town: Mosman, Municipality of Mosman, New South Wales
Schooling: Neutral Bay Public School
Occupation: Plumber

Biography contributed by Faithe Jones

Son of the late Robert and Elizabeth WITCOMBE

Husband of Marion Gertrude WITCOMBE, 14 Cabramatta Road, Mosman, New South Wales.

Served in Rabaul as garrison plumber assisting in the erection of the wirless mast at Bita Paka.  Contracted malaria fever and returned to Austrlaia.

Discharged March 8, 1918
